About (E)-3-(2-ethyl-4-methoxyphenyl)hex-2-enoic acid
(E)-3-(2-ethyl-4-methoxyphenyl)hex-2-enoic acid (PubChem CID 83959086) has the molecular formula C15H20O3
and a molecular weight of 248.32 g/mol. Its IUPAC name is (E)-3-(2-ethyl-4-methoxyphenyl)hex-2-enoic acid.
